			<description>Kids3, that is a very good question and anyone buying a dog from a pet shop should ask that question.  A reputable breeder would leave contact information.  I am a breeder and anyone showing up about buying a dog of mine is interviewed carefully.  It's not first come, first served and I have had some very angry people leave my place because I refused to sell them a puppy.  Thankfully, my dogs are almost exclusively sold to friends of people who have one of my dogs.  I hate pet shops selling puppies as anyone with the money in his pocket can buy one and I think many pet shop purchases are impulse buys.  Getting a dog should be a well thought out, researched purchase as it is (or should be) a long term commitment.   - travhops</description>
